What is the difference between Freelance Rendering Engineer vs 3D Artist?

AspectFreelance Rendering Engineer3D Artist
Required CredentialsKnowledge of rendering software, computer graphics, and programmingProficiency in 3D modeling, texturing, and artistic skills
Work EnvironmentProject-based, remote or on-site, collaborating with developers and studiosCreative studios, freelance projects, or personal portfolios
Industry UsageUsed in gaming, film, visualization, and software developmentUsed in entertainment, advertising, and product visualization

While both roles involve computer graphics, a Freelance Rendering Engineer focuses on optimizing and developing rendering techniques, often requiring programming skills. A 3D Artist emphasizes creating visual content through modeling and texturing. The roles overlap in visual output but differ in technical expertise and responsibilities.
